Who is Dr. Dorf, Family Medicine Specialist in Derry, NH?
Dr. Robert Dorf, DO is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Derry, NH with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Family Medicine.
Dr. Dorf is fluent in English and Portuguese,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Dorf’s practice accepts Cigna,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ans. To book an appointment or to confirm insurance options, please call Dr. Dorf’s office at (603) 577-3080.

What is Dr. Robert Dorf's specialty?
Dr. Dorf is a Family Medicine Specialist near Derry, NH.
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.
